#7e2229 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e2229 is composed of 49.4% red, 13.3%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73% magenta, 67.5%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 355.4 degrees, a saturation of 57.5% and a lightness of 31.4%. #7e2229 color hex could be obtained by blending #fc4452 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#7e2229 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e2229 has RGB values of R:126, G:34,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.67,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8266281.
